Goa Region Orienteering Championship – GOA

The Goa Region Orienteering Championship was successfully conducted with great enthusiasm and sportsmanship, bringing together young navigators from across the region. Hosted amidst the scenic surroundings of Goa, the championship witnessed spirited participation, competitive energy, and exceptional display of navigation and endurance skills.

A total of 145 students from five participating schools competed across multiple categories—Under-17, Under-14, and Under-12, for both boys and girls. The participating schools were:

  1. GAET International School
  2. The King’s School
  3. Dr. K. B. Hedgewar High School
  4. St. Rita’s High School
  5. Santa Cruz Higher Secondary School

The event layout was thoughtfully designed, ensuring that participants experienced real-time map reading, terrain navigation, and decision-making challenges. Each student demonstrated courage, focus, and determination while navigating through the course.


Category-wise Results

Under 17 – Boys

  • 1st Place: Shreejit Vaibhav Gadgil – Dr. K.B.Hedgewar High School
  • 2nd Place: Vedant Shet – St.Rita’s High School
  • 3rd Place: Atharv Kalangutkar – St.Rita’s High School

Under 17 – Girls

  • 1st Place: Urvi V. Desai – Dr. K.B.Hedgewar High School & Ketaki S. Joshi – Dr. K.B.Hedgewar High School
  • 2nd Place: Sara Nishad Shaikh – GAET International School

Under 14 – Boys

  • 1st Place: Sufiyan – Santa Cruz High Secondary School
  • 2nd Place: Muzammil Saiyed – Santa Cruz High Secondary School
  • 3rd Place: Ali Hasan Tashildar – Santa Cruz High Secondary School

 

Under 14 – Girls

  • 1st Place: Sarin Nitin Pokle – Dr. K.B.Hedgewar High School
  • 2nd Place: Mehvish Attar – Dr. K.B.Hedgewar High School
  • 3rd Place: Sadhvi P. Bhandari – GAET International School

Under 12 – Boys

  • 1st Place: Skyler Kroner Fernandes – The King’s School
  • 2nd Place: Blake Fernandes – The King’s School
  • 3rd Place: : Datt Shashank Keni – The King’s School

Under 12 – Girls

  • 1st Place: Anushka Wakil – GAET International School
  • 2nd Place: Amily & Maya – GAET International School
  • 3rd Place: Gorochara Pori – The King’s School
